Portfolio diversification continues to be among one of the most fundamental concepts in financial investment administration, serving as the cornerstone of sensible economic approach. This approach involves spreading financial investments across asset classes, geographical areas, and market sectors to minimize overall risk exposure whilst maintaining development potential. The concept operates on the principle that different investments carry out variously under different market conditions, thereby reducing volatility and securing against substantial losses in any single area. Modern diversification strategies extend traditional stocks and bonds to include different financial investments such as real estate investment trusts, commodities, and international markets. Successful diversification requires careful consideration of relationship between different asset classes, ensuring that financial investments do not move in tandem during market stress. Risk-adjusted returns provide a more advanced gauge of investment efficiency than simple return calculations, integrating the degree of risk required to attain those yields into the evaluation process. Financial portfolio analysis acknowledges that higher returns often include boosted volatility and potential for loss, making it important to evaluate if extra yields validate the increased threat. Typical risk-modified measures comprise the Sharpe ratio, gauging excess yield per unit of danger, and the Treynor ratio, focusing on systematic risk concerning market changes. Asset allocation strategies and wealth management services form the tactical foundation of financial investment preparation, determining how capital is allocated across read more numerous investment categories to attain particular financial goals. These methods typically involve a systematic approach to dividing investments between equities, fixed income securities, money equivalents, and alternative financial investments, based on individual risk tolerance, investment timeline, and financial goals. Strategic asset allotment involves establishing target percents for each asset class and periodically rebalancing to maintain these targets, whilst tactical asset allocation allows for temporary deviations based on market scenarios and chances. Age-based assignment models suggest that younger investors can afford to take greater risks with higher equity allocations, whilst those nearing retirement should gradually shift towards more conservative investments.
